Home
last modified time | relevance | path

Searched refs:symbols_ (Results 1 – 6 of 6) sorted by relevance

/system/core/libunwindstack/
DSymbols.h50 symbols_.clear(); in ClearCache()
70 std::unordered_map<uint32_t, Info> symbols_; // Cache of read symbols (keyed by symbol index). variable
DSymbols.cpp48 auto it = symbols_.find(symbol_index); in ReadFuncInfo()
49 if (it != symbols_.end()) { in ReadFuncInfo()
61 return &symbols_.emplace(symbol_index, info).first->second; in ReadFuncInfo()
133 symbols_.clear(); // Remove cached symbols since the access pattern will be different. in GetName()
DElfInterface.cpp43 for (auto symbol : symbols_) { in ~ElfInterface()
368 symbols_.push_back(new Symbols(shdr.sh_offset, shdr.sh_size, shdr.sh_entsize, in ReadSectionHeaders()
476 if (symbols_.empty()) { in GetFunctionNameWithTemplate()
480 for (const auto symbol : symbols_) { in GetFunctionNameWithTemplate()
490 if (symbols_.empty()) { in GetGlobalVariableWithTemplate()
494 for (const auto symbol : symbols_) { in GetGlobalVariableWithTemplate()
/system/extras/simpleperf/
Ddso.cpp344 auto it = std::upper_bound(symbols_.begin(), symbols_.end(), in FindSymbol()
347 if (it != symbols_.begin()) { in FindSymbol()
363 symbols_ = std::move(*symbols); in SetSymbols()
387 if (symbols_.empty()) { in Load()
388 symbols_ = std::move(symbols); in Load()
391 std::set_union(symbols_.begin(), symbols_.end(), symbols.begin(), symbols.end(), in Load()
393 symbols_ = std::move(merged_symbols); in Load()
465 android::base::LogSeverity level = symbols_.empty() ? android::base::WARNING in LoadSymbols()
571 symbols_.empty() ? android::base::WARNING : android::base::DEBUG); in LoadSymbols()
680 symbols_.empty() ? android::base::WARNING : android::base::DEBUG); in LoadSymbols()
Ddso.h184 const std::vector<Symbol>& GetSymbols() { return symbols_; } in GetSymbols()
216 std::vector<Symbol> symbols_; variable
/system/core/libunwindstack/include/unwindstack/
DElfInterface.h182 std::vector<Symbols*> symbols_; variable